引言 近年来,区块链技术的兴起引发了全球金融市场的深刻变革。作为一种去中心化的分布式账本技术,区块链不仅...
随着区块链技术的迅速发展,越来越多的人开始关注与之相关的学习资源。其中,刷题软件作为提高学习效率的重要工具,正受到广泛的推崇。本文将为大家介绍一些优质的区块链刷题软件,并评测其特点和优缺点,帮助学习者在准备区块链相关考试或提升编程能力时做出明智的选择。
区块链技术不仅涉及加密货币,还已应用于金融、供应链管理、物联网等多个领域。因此,学习区块链技术的必要性日益增强。在这一背景下,建立一个系统的学习框架尤为重要,而刷题软件就是实现这一目标的有力工具之一。
区块链刷题软件的主要功能通常包括但不限于:
接下来,我们将详细介绍几款比较受欢迎的区块链刷题软件,包括它们的特点、优缺点以及适用人群。
CryptoZombies 是一个互动性的区块链编程学习网站,非常适合初学者。它通过建立一个自己的僵尸游戏来引导学习者逐步掌握 Solidity(以太坊智能合约编程语言)。
优点:
缺点:
虽然 LeetCode 是一个通用的编程刷题平台,但它也包含了一些与区块链相关的问题,特别是在数据结构与算法部分。用户通过解答这些问题,可以增强自己的编码能力,为区块链技术的学习打下基础。
优点:
缺点:
与 LeetCode 类似,HackerRank 提供了一个较为全面的编程挑战平台。它提供的区块链编程挑战,给予用户一个实践和应用的机会,用于提高其在实际环境中的编程能力。
优点:
缺点:
在选择区块链刷题软件时,有几个重要的考虑因素:
区块链刷题软件通过提供针对性的练习,能够显著提高用户的学习效率。首先,它可以找出用户知识的薄弱环节,让用户能有针对性地加强学习。其次,模拟考试功能能帮助用户熟悉考场环境和题型,从而减轻考试时的焦虑。此外,刷题软件通常会提供详细的解析,帮助用户理解每个问题的解法和原理。
评估刷题软件的质量可以从多个方面考虑,包括:题库的丰富程度、题目的难度和多样性、用户界面的友好程度、反馈机制的及时性等。用户还可以参考其他学习者的评价和建议,选择适合自己的软件。
区块链技术近年来得到了广泛应用,不仅仅局限于加密货币领域。金融、供应链、医疗等多个行业都开始探索区块链技术的潜在应用。未来,随着技术的不断成熟,区块链的应用场景将越来越广泛,市场需求也将持续增长。因此,学习区块链技术,将为个人的职业发展带来更多机会。
自学区块链技术的最佳路径通常包括以下几个阶段:初步了解区块链的基本概念,掌握至少一种区块链平台(如以太坊、Hyperledger等),系统学习智能合约编程,并进行实践项目开发。结合使用刷题软件进行巩固,可以加速学习过程。
许多用户在使用刷题软件时发现,适合自己的学习方式至关重要。比如,有的人更喜欢通过做题来学习,而有的人则倾向于看视频或阅读。找到适合自己的学习方式,结合刷题软件的特点,合理安排学习时间,将会取得更好的效果。另外,参与到相关的学习社区中,可以获得更广泛的支持和帮助,从而提升自学的积极性和效率。
总结来说,区块链刷题软件为学习者提供了一个高效且系统化的学习工具。在选择合适的软件时,应根据自身的需求和目标进行全面评估,并合理规划学习过程。希望本文提供的信息和建议,能够帮助广大区块链学习者在讲求效率的时代中,稳步前行,实现自己的学习目标。